Engine and Performance

The Street Triple RX uses a 765cc inline-three engine shared with the latest Triumph Street Triple lineup. It produces around 128.2 hp at 12,000 rpm and 80 Nm of torque at 9,500 rpm, delivering strong acceleration, smooth mid-range power, and a thrilling top-end. The engine is paired with a 6-speed transmission that offers precise shifts and excellent gearing for both city use and spirited highway riding. Suspension and Handling

For confident cornering and stability, the street triple rx features Ohlins NIX30 fully adjustable USD front forks and an adjustable Ohlins rear monoshock. This suspension setup strikes a balance between sporty stiffness and daily comfort, making the bike agile in traffic and rock-solid at higher speeds. The lightweight chassis allows the street triple 765 rx to tip into corners effortlessly, delivering sharp and precise handling.

Tyres and Wheels

The bike rides on 17-inch alloy wheels paired with sport-oriented tyres – 120/70 ZR17 at the front and 180/55 ZR17 at the rear. These tyres offer excellent grip during acceleration, braking, and cornering, helping the triumph street triple maintain stability and confidence on both the road and track.

Braking System

Braking performance is handled by dual 310 mm front discs with 4-piston calipers and a 220 mm rear disc. The setup delivers strong stopping power with a progressive lever feel, while ABS ensures added safety without overly interfering with sporty riding. The system gives the street triple 765 rx reliable control even during aggressive braking.

Technology and Features

With cutting-edge technology, the Street Triple RX offers cornering ABS, advanced traction control, and an Triumph Shift Assist. The bike also features customizable riding modes: Road, Rain, Sport, and Track. Each mode adjusts the bike’s performance characteristics to suit different riding conditions and preferences, ensuring an optimal and tailored riding experience.

Triumph Street Triple RX Specifications & Features

Engine and Performance:

Engine Type: Inline 3 cylinder, DOHC

Engine Capacity: 765 cc

Max Power: 128.2 bhp @ 12,000 RPM

Torque: 80 Nm @ 9,500 RPM

Transmission: 6 speed manual

Cooling System: Liquid cooled

Number of Valves: 12

Bore x Stroke: 78mm x 53.4mm

Compression Ratio: 13.25:1

Type of Clutch: Wet, multi-plate

Assist & Slipper Clutch: Yes

Fuel Type: Petrol

Fuel System: Electronic fuel injection with electronic throttle Control

Fuel Tank Capacity: 15 ltrs | 4 gal

Mileage: Not Specified

Top Speed: Not Specified

Emission Level: BS6 Phase 2 | Euro 5+

Suspension, Tires, and Wheels:

Front Suspension: Ohlins NIX30 USD forks, adjustable

Rear Suspension: Ohlins STX40 Monoshock, adjustable

Front Tyre: 120/70 ZR 17

Rear Tyre: 180/55 ZR 17

Tyre Type: Tubeless

Wheels: Cast aluminium Alloy

Swingarm: Twin-sided, cast aluminium alloy

Braking System:

Front Brakes: Twin 310 mm discs (Brembo Stylema)

Rear Brake: Single 220 mm disc (Brembo)

ABS: Cornering ABS

Dimensions:

Length: 2,051 mm | 80.7″

Width: 765 mm | 30.1″

Height: 1,051 mm | 41.3″

Wheelbase: 1,397 mm | 55″

Kerb Weight: 188 kg | 414.5 lbs

Seat Height: 839 mm | 33″
